Book excerpt: Excerpt from Camping Tramping: With Roosevelt This little volume really needs no intro duction; the, two sketches Of which it is made explain and, I hope, justify them selves. But there is one phase of the President's many-sided character upon which I should like to lay especial em phasis, namely, his natural history bent and knowledge. Amid all his absorbing interests and masterful activities in other fields, his interest and his authority in practical natural history are by no means the least. I long ago had very direct proof Of this statement. In some Of my English sketches, following a Visit to that island in 1882, I had, rather by implication than by positive statement, inclined to the opinion that the European forms of ani mal life were, as a rule, larger and more hardy and prolific than the corresponding.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Alastair Borthwick's classic tale of camping, hiking and climbing tells of the freedom and fellowship enjoyed by climbers in Scotland in the 1930s. His beautiful, vivid descriptions of the landscape are only rivalled by his colourfully drawn, highly entertaining cast of characters, all of whom are passionate about the outdoors and their place within it. Borthwick takes his reader - via road, campsite and bothy - from Arrochar to Glencoe; from the Cuillin to Lairig Ghru. Encounters with tramps, tinkers and hawkers, and of hitching to Ben Nevis in a lorry full of dead sheep, are all described in Borthwick's light-hearted style. He weaves a hilarious tale, aided by the eccentric folk he meets, and this light-hearted read continues to delight, decades after it was first published.
